Subject: Re: [PATCH 4/6] MIPS: refactor the maybe coherent DMA indicators

On Mon, Feb 08, 2021 at 03:50:22PM +0100, Christoph Hellwig wrote:
> Replace the global coherentio enum, and the hw_coherentio (fake) boolean
> variables with a single boolean dma_default_coherent flag.  Only the
> malta setup code needs two additional local boolean variables to
> preserved the command line overrides.

this breaks overriding of coherentio via command line. plat_mem_setup/
plat_setup_iocoherency is called before earlyparams are handled. So
changing coherentio after that doesn't have any effect.
